HCLTech occupies a distinctive position in the Indian IT services industry — simultaneously the most engineering-focused of the large Indian IT companies, the most aggressive acquirer of software product IP, and the company that has most consistently articulated a credible strategy for transitioning from labor-arbitrage IT outsourcing toward technology-led, IP-driven services that command higher margins and stronger client retention. The company's origins trace to 1976, when Shiv Nadar and five colleagues left their jobs at DCM Data Products to establish Hindustan Computers Limited, a hardware company that assembled minicomputers in an era when India's technology industry was in its infancy. The early decades were defined by hardware manufacturing and the gradual development of software engineering capability, positioning HCL as a technology company rather than a pure services organization from the outset — a distinction that would prove strategically important as the industry evolved. The transformation into a global IT services company accelerated in the 1990s and 2000s as HCL invested aggressively in engineering services capabilities — particularly embedded systems, semiconductor design, and aerospace and defense technology development — that differentiated it from competitors like TCS and Infosys whose service offerings were more heavily concentrated in enterprise application management, business process outsourcing, and IT infrastructure services. HCL's engineering pedigree attracted clients in industries including aerospace, automotive, semiconductor, and industrial manufacturing who needed genuine engineering expertise rather than software development capacity. The 2017 announcement of HCL's acquisition of several IBM software products — ultimately executed as a 1.8 billion dollar deal completed in 2019 for products including Notes/Domino, Appscan, BigFix, Commerce, Portal, and Connections — was the most controversial and consequential strategic decision in the company's recent history. Acquiring mature, declining IBM software products was widely criticized at the time as a value trap: why would a growth-oriented IT services company pay 1.8 billion dollars for software that IBM had been unable to grow? HCLTech's answer — that it could reposition these products for hybrid cloud deployments, invest in product development that IBM had deferred, and cross-sell them through the company's existing enterprise client relationships — has proven substantially correct. The HCL Software division generates approximately 1.5 billion dollars in annual revenue with software-characteristic margins that are materially higher than services revenue, validating the acquisition thesis. The Mode 1-2-3 strategic framework, articulated by CEO C Vijayakumar and refined over several years, provides the conceptual architecture for understanding HCLTech's business portfolio. Mode 1 encompasses traditional IT services — application management, infrastructure management, and business process outsourcing — that generate the largest revenue share but face commoditization pressure and margin compression. Mode 2 encompasses next-generation digital services — cloud migration, cybersecurity, data analytics, AI implementation, and digital transformation programs — that are growing faster and command better margins. Mode 3 is the IP-led products and platforms business through HCL Software, which generates recurring subscription revenue with the highest margins in the portfolio. The framework's value is not merely definitional — it provides a road map for client relationship evolution, resource allocation, and investor communication that competitors without an equivalent structured framework struggle to articulate as coherently. HCLTech's engineering and R&D services business — which generates approximately 20 to 22% of total revenue — is a genuine competitive differentiator in a market where most Indian IT peers have limited depth in embedded systems, VLSI design, product lifecycle management, and engineering simulation. The company's relationships with automotive OEMs, semiconductor manufacturers, aerospace primes, and industrial equipment companies reflect engineering credibility that has been built over decades and cannot be replicated through business development investment alone. As the automotive industry's software content increases — driven by electrification, ADAS, and connected vehicle technology — and as semiconductor companies face increasing complexity in chip design and validation, HCL's engineering services positioning becomes more rather than less strategically relevant. The company's workforce of approximately 225,000 employees spans 60 countries, with the largest concentrations in India (primarily Noida, Chennai, Bangalore, and Pune), the United States, Europe, and Australia. The talent model combines offshore delivery efficiency with onshore client-facing capability, a balance that HCLTech has managed with more flexibility than some peers in adapting to client preferences for higher local delivery ratios following the COVID-19 pandemic's demonstration that remote delivery is operationally viable.

HCLTech, formerly known as HCL Technologies, is an Indian multinational information technology services and consulting company headquartered in Noida, India. The company is part of the HCL Group, which was founded in 1976 by entrepreneur Shiv Nadar. Initially established as Hindustan Computers Limited, the organization began as a hardware manufacturer during the early development of the Indian computing industry. HCL played a significant role in introducing indigenous computer systems in India at a time when the country was beginning to develop its domestic technology capabilities.
During the 1980s and early 1990s the company expanded from computer hardware manufacturing into software development and information technology services. This transition aligned with the rapid growth of the global software services industry and the increasing demand for outsourced technology solutions. HCL Technologies was formally established as a separate entity in 1991 to focus on software development, IT infrastructure services, and enterprise technology consulting.
Throughout the late 1990s and early 2000s HCLTech expanded internationally, opening development centers and offices across North America, Europe, and Asia. The company developed expertise in infrastructure management, engineering services, and enterprise software solutions. One of HCLTech's distinctive strategies involved focusing on engineering-driven IT services and complex enterprise technology solutions.
Today HCLTech provides a broad range of services including digital transformation consulting, cloud computing solutions, cybersecurity services, engineering services, and IT infrastructure management. The company serves clients in industries such as banking, healthcare, telecommunications, manufacturing, aerospace, and retail. With a large global workforce and operations in multiple countries, HCLTech has become one of the largest IT services companies originating from India and continues to invest in emerging technologies including artificial intelligence, digital engineering, and cloud platforms. HCLTech's financial performance over the past five years reflects the compound effect of the Mode 1-2-3 strategy executing as designed: consistent revenue growth driven by Mode 2 digital services expansion and Mode 3 software subscription scaling, with improving margin quality as the mix shifts toward higher-margin segments. In fiscal year 2024 (ending March 2024), HCLTech reported revenue of approximately 13.3 billion dollars, representing growth of approximately 5% in constant currency terms — modestly below the company's medium-term growth target range of 6 to 8% but reflecting the demand softness that affected the broader IT services industry as enterprise clients deferred discretionary technology spending in an uncertain macroeconomic environment. Operating margins have been a consistent focus of investor attention. HCLTech's EBIT margins have historically ranged between 18 and 20%, broadly comparable to Infosys and below TCS's industry-leading 24 to 26% range. The HCL Software segment's higher margins provide a structural mix tailwind that should gradually improve the blended margin profile, but the engineering services segment's higher-cost, specialized-talent model constrains the overall margin ceiling relative to companies whose revenue mix is more heavily weighted toward offshore IT application services. The IBM software acquisition's financial contribution has validated the 1.8 billion dollar investment thesis. HCL Software generates approximately 1.4 to 1.5 billion dollars in annual revenue with EBIT margins estimated at 25 to 30% — significantly above the company's blended margin — and subscription revenue growth in the mid-single digits as HCLTech invests in product modernization that converts clients from perpetual licenses to cloud-delivered subscriptions. The net present value of the acquired revenue streams, at the discount rates applicable to predictable enterprise software subscription revenue, significantly exceeds the acquisition price. Return on equity and free cash flow generation have been robust, reflecting the asset-light nature of the services business model and the strong working capital management that characterizes well-run IT services companies. HCLTech has maintained a consistent dividend policy and share buyback program that returns capital to shareholders while retaining flexibility for strategic acquisitions.

HCLTech's business model is organized around three service lines that together address the full spectrum of enterprise technology requirements from traditional IT operations to cutting-edge engineering and product development, generating revenue through a combination of time-and-material contracts, fixed-price engagements, managed services agreements, and software subscription licenses. The IT and Business Services segment — the largest revenue contributor at approximately 55 to 60% of total revenue — encompasses application development and management, digital transformation services, enterprise resource planning implementation and management, cybersecurity services, cloud migration and management, and business process outsourcing. This segment competes most directly with TCS, Infosys, Wipro, and Accenture, where pricing pressure and commoditization are most intense. HCLTech's differentiation within this segment comes from its DRYiCE AI platform for IT operations automation, its Cloud Smart framework for structured cloud migration, and the cross-selling of HCL Software products that deepens client relationships beyond pure services delivery. The Engineering and R&D Services segment — generating approximately 20 to 22% of revenue — provides product engineering services to companies in the semiconductor, aerospace and defense, automotive, medical devices, industrial equipment, and consumer electronics industries. Services include hardware design, embedded software development, VLSI design, mechanical engineering, system integration, and product testing. This segment commands higher margins than comparable IT services due to the scarcity of engineers with specialized domain expertise, the stickiness of long-term product development relationships, and the IP ownership arrangements that often accompany multi-year engineering programs. The segment's growth is driven by the accelerating software content of physical products across every major industry — a secular trend that will sustain demand for engineering services through the next decade and beyond. The HCL Software segment — the smallest by revenue at approximately 8 to 10% but the most margin-accretive — operates as an enterprise software products business selling perpetual licenses and subscription contracts for the portfolio of products acquired from IBM in 2019 and subsequently developed organically. Products including BigFix (endpoint security and management), AppScan (application security testing), Domino (enterprise collaboration and low-code application development), Commerce (e-commerce platform), and DRYiCE (AI-powered IT operations) are sold to enterprise clients globally, often cross-sold through existing HCLTech service relationships. The subscription revenue model generates predictable annual recurring revenue with renewal rates that reflect the switching costs inherent in deeply integrated enterprise software. The pricing model varies significantly across segments. Engineering services engagements are typically time-and-material contracts with senior engineers at rates reflecting skill scarcity and domain expertise. IT services contracts span the full spectrum from time-and-material to outcome-based pricing where HCLTech shares the financial upside of productivity improvements delivered. Software products are sold through annual subscription agreements with enterprise volume pricing that rewards expansion within accounts. The mix of pricing models creates revenue predictability that time-and-material-only competitors lack. HCLTech's go-to-market model relies on a combination of direct enterprise sales, industry-specific solution units (ISUs) that bundle service and software capabilities for specific verticals, and an ecosystem of technology alliance partnerships with hyperscalers including AWS, Microsoft Azure, and Google Cloud. The alliance partnerships provide implementation deal flow as clients seek certified implementation partners for major cloud platform deployments, and they provide training and certification programs that build the workforce skills necessary to deliver at scale.
HCLTech's growth strategy for the next three to five years is organized around three vectors: accelerating AI services revenue through the HCL AI Force framework, expanding HCL Software's subscription revenue base through product modernization and cloud delivery, and deepening engineering services penetration in automotive and semiconductor verticals where the technology transition is creating new service demand. The AI services strategy — branded as HCL AI Force — represents HCLTech's response to the generative AI disruption that is simultaneously threatening traditional IT services margins and creating new demand for AI implementation, integration, and governance services. HCL AI Force encompasses AI-powered automation tools that improve the productivity of HCLTech's own delivery workforce, AI implementation services for clients building generative AI applications, and AI-ready infrastructure services for clients deploying GPU compute for AI workloads. The strategy's dual orientation — using AI to improve internal efficiency while selling AI implementation to clients — is common across the IT services industry, but HCLTech's execution has been faster than most peers in quantifying and communicating the productivity benefit. The engineering services expansion in automotive is particularly well-timed. The transition from internal combustion to electric vehicles requires automotive OEMs to develop software capabilities at a scale that dwarfs their historical engineering organizations — software-defined vehicles require tens of millions of lines of code for powertrain management, ADAS, infotainment, and over-the-air update systems that traditional automotive engineers are not trained to develop. HCLTech's existing relationships with major European and American automotive OEMs, combined with its software engineering depth, position it to capture a disproportionate share of the engineering services demand generated by this transition.

HCLTech competes in the global IT services market against a hierarchy of competitors that spans Indian IT majors, global technology consultancies, and specialized engineering services firms — each with distinct competitive strengths and strategic positioning. TCS is the most formidable competitor and the benchmark against which Indian IT peers are measured. TCS's competitive advantages include its unmatched scale (approximately 600,000 employees, 29 billion dollars in revenue), client relationship depth across the Global 500, and margin leadership at 24 to 26% EBIT — reflecting the productivity of its highly optimized offshore delivery model. TCS's breadth of service coverage and client tenure make it exceptionally difficult to displace in large, complex accounts, and its financial strength enables the client investments and outcome-based pricing structures that influence large deal decisions. HCLTech competes with TCS primarily by emphasizing engineering services differentiation and the HCL Software product portfolio — capabilities where TCS has less depth. Infosys competes most directly with HCLTech in the digital transformation and cloud services segments, where Infosys's Cobalt cloud framework and Topaz AI platform have been positioned as direct competitors to HCLTech's equivalent offerings. Infosys has been more aggressive in communicating AI strategy and has achieved stronger revenue growth in the digital services segment in recent quarters, creating competitive pressure on HCLTech's narrative positioning. HCLTech's differentiator against Infosys is the engineering services business and HCL Software — both of which Infosys lacks equivalent capabilities in. Accenture competes at the premium end of the market, where its management consulting capabilities, C-suite relationships, and technology implementation depth justify significantly higher billing rates than Indian IT peers can command. Accenture's competitive strength in the strategy-through-execution model — where consulting engagements convert into large implementation programs — is difficult for HCLTech to replicate without equivalent consulting credibility. HCLTech competes with Accenture primarily on price and engineering depth rather than strategic advisory capability.

HCLTech's outlook over the next five years is shaped by the interplay of three forces: the generative AI transition's impact on IT services demand and delivery models, the engineering services opportunity created by automotive and semiconductor technology transformation, and HCL Software's progression from legacy product stabilization to cloud-native product growth. The AI services opportunity is the most immediate and largest. Enterprise spending on AI implementation, integration, and governance is growing rapidly, and HCLTech's positioning — with engineering credibility, enterprise client relationships, and a software product portfolio that includes AI-powered IT operations tools — provides a credible platform for capturing this spending. The HCL AI Force framework's industrial AI orientation, targeting manufacturing, automotive, and engineering clients where HCLTech already has relationships, is a more focused and defensible AI strategy than generic enterprise AI implementation services. The engineering services trajectory over the next five years is favorable for multiple concurrent reasons. Automotive electrification and software-defined vehicle development is accelerating, semiconductor design complexity is increasing with each process node generation, aerospace and defense modernization programs are consuming engineering capacity, and industrial equipment manufacturers are embedding more software in their products. Each of these trends expands the addressable market for HCLTech's engineering services without requiring market share gains from competitors — the market is growing faster than the existing supply of qualified engineering services providers. HCL Software's long-term potential remains the most underappreciated element of HCLTech's story. If the software products can be successfully transitioned to cloud delivery models with competitive feature roadmaps, the segment could reach 2 to 2.5 billion dollars in annual revenue with margins that transform HCLTech's blended profitability profile. The BigFix endpoint security platform is particularly well-positioned in a cybersecurity market where endpoint management and security integration is a growing enterprise priority.

Generative AI tools including GitHub Copilot, Cursor, and enterprise coding assistants are demonstrably improving software development productivity — with studies suggesting 20 to 40% efficiency gains for experienced developers — creating risk that large managed application services contracts are renegotiated at lower headcount and therefore lower revenue as clients capture the productivity benefit rather than allowing it to flow to HCLTech's margins.
HCL Software's product portfolio faces competitive pressure from SaaS-native alternatives in each of its product categories — Crowdstrike and Microsoft in endpoint security competing with BigFix, Veracode and Checkmarx competing with AppScan, and Microsoft Teams and Slack displacing Domino as enterprise collaboration platforms — requiring sustained product investment to prevent client attrition to modern alternatives with superior user experiences.

Competitive Moat: HCLTech's competitive advantages are concentrated in three areas that collectively differentiate it from peers who are primarily IT services companies without equivalent engineering depth or software product ownership. The engineering and R&D services capability is the most structurally distinctive advantage. HCLTech has invested for over three decades in the domain expertise, specialized talent, and client relationships necessary to serve as a genuine engineering partner to companies in aerospace, automotive, semiconductor, and industrial sectors. This capability is not replicable through recruitment drives or business development investment alone — it requires accumulated project experience, engineering tool expertise, and regulatory knowledge that only decades of sustained practice can build. The automotive software transition is expanding rather than eroding this advantage, as new software engineering demands exceed automotive OEMs' internal capacity and require specialized partners. The HCL Software product portfolio provides recurring revenue diversification and margin enhancement that pure-play IT services companies cannot match. The ability to sell enterprise software products — with their predictable subscription renewal economics and higher margins — alongside services creates cross-selling opportunities, deepens client account penetration, and provides revenue stability that smooths the lumpiness inherent in project-based services revenue. No Indian IT peer owns a comparable software product portfolio with enterprise-grade installed bases. The Mode 1-2-3 framework provides strategic clarity and investor communication coherence that positions HCLTech as a deliberate, self-aware technology company rather than a pure IT services vendor. The framework's explicit acknowledgment of commoditization pressure in traditional IT services — and the structured investment program for transitioning to higher-value segments — gives investors and clients a roadmap for understanding the company's evolution that has been consistently executed against over five years.

Engineering Thought Leadership
HCLTech publishes technical white papers, industry reports, and engineering case studies through its TechBee and research platforms that build credibility among engineering decision-makers in automotive, aerospace, and semiconductor industries — a thought leadership approach that generates inbound interest from clients seeking engineering partners rather than requiring outbound sales-led deal generation.
Supercharging Partner Ecosystem
HCLTech markets its capabilities through a structured ecosystem of technology partnerships with AWS, Microsoft, Google Cloud, SAP, and Salesforce, positioning as the preferred implementation partner for these platforms' enterprise customers — generating deal flow from hyperscaler and platform partner referrals that supplements direct sales efforts.
HCL Software Product Marketing
HCL Software markets its enterprise products through direct enterprise sales, channel partner networks, and participation in security and enterprise technology analyst reports from Gartner and Forrester — investing in analyst relations to maintain Magic Quadrant positions that enterprise procurement teams rely on for vendor shortlisting in endpoint security, application security, and collaboration categories.
Industry Solution Unit Marketing
HCLTech's Industry Solution Units (ISUs) bundle service and software capabilities for specific verticals — financial services, life sciences, manufacturing, retail — and market integrated solutions that address industry-specific digital transformation challenges, enabling more relevant conversations with line-of-business leaders who have specific operational problems rather than generic IT requirements.
HCLTech is building the HCL AI Force platform — an integrated suite of generative AI tools for code generation, test automation, documentation, and IT operations — that will be used internally to improve delivery productivity and sold externally as an AI augmentation platform for enterprise software development and IT operations teams.
HCLTech's DRYiCE platform applies AI and machine learning to IT operations management — automating incident detection, root cause analysis, change management, and service desk interactions — evolving the platform through continuous research investment to address the AI-powered ITSM market where ServiceNow and BMC Software are the incumbent competitors.
HCL Software is investing in BigFix product development to extend endpoint management capabilities into zero-trust security architecture compliance, cloud workload management, and AI-driven vulnerability prioritization — modernizing the product's positioning against CrowdStrike and Microsoft Defender in the endpoint security market.
HCLTech's engineering research in automotive software focuses on AUTOSAR-compliant software development, ADAS algorithm development and validation, electric vehicle battery management system software, and over-the-air update infrastructure — building the specialized capabilities required to serve automotive OEMs through the software-defined vehicle transition.
HCLTech is conducting early-stage research into quantum computing applications for financial modeling, drug discovery simulation, and supply chain optimization, developing the expertise and toolchain familiarity that will be required to deliver quantum computing implementation services as the technology matures toward enterprise applicability in the late 2020s.
